Minnesota Employment Application and Job Offer Package for a Graphic Designer: When applying for a graphic designer position in Minnesota, it is essential to have a well-prepared Employment Application and Job Offer Package. This package typically consists of various documents and forms that both the applicant and employer need to complete and review throughout the hiring process. These documents serve as a legal agreement between the employer and the employee, ensuring that both parties understand the terms of employment. The Minnesota Employment Application for a Graphic Designer is the first document that a candidate is required to complete. It gathers essential information such as personal details, contact information, educational background, work experience, and references. The application helps the employer assess a candidate's qualifications and suitability for the graphic designer role and allows the applicant to present their skills and abilities effectively. Apart from the application, the Job Offer Package for a Graphic Designer in Minnesota may include the following additional documents: 1. Job Description: This document outlines the specific duties, responsibilities, and expectations of the graphic designer position. It provides applicants with a clear understanding of the scope of work, necessary skills, and qualifications required for the role. 2. Employment Agreement: This legally binding document formalizes the terms and conditions of employment, including compensation, benefits, work hours, confidentiality agreements, intellectual property rights, termination clauses, and non-compete agreements. It protects both the employee and the employer by clearly defining their rights and obligations. 3. Background Check Authorization Form: Some employers may require candidates to undergo a background check, especially if the graphic design position involves working with sensitive information or clients. This form grants consent to the employer to conduct the necessary investigations. 4. Non-Disclosure Agreement (NDA): In some cases, employers may require graphic designers to sign an NDA, particularly if they handle confidential information or proprietary design work. This agreement ensures that the designer will not disclose any confidential information, trade secrets, or client data to third parties. 5. W-4 Form: The W-4 form is a standard federal tax document that determines the amount of federal income tax withheld from an employee's paycheck. Graphic designers in Minnesota are required to complete this form to comply with federal tax regulations. By utilizing these Minnesota Employment Application and Job Offer Package documents for a Graphic Designer role, both the employer and applicant can establish a clear understanding of the job requirements, terms of employment, and legal obligations. It is important to read and review all documents carefully before signing to ensure full comprehension and adherence to Minnesota employment laws and regulations. Please note that specific industry or company requirements may lead to variations in the contents of the package, but the fundamental documents mentioned above are commonly included in such packages for graphic designers in Minnesota.
